    in the display of ranking over time, the vertical axis (about 200 or 300) is squashed down into about 1 inch of vertical computer scree. In effect this makes it difficult to see the trend over time -- hundreds of points difference is all smoothed out into almost a flat line. Notice that because of this, the displays for ALL players look essentially the same! There are some great books on how best to display information; the best books are be Edward R, Tufte.
